Why does Crysis run bad?
A common criticism of Crysis was that it was poorly optimized for multicore CPUs. While most top-end gaming PCs sported dual core processors prior to the game being launched, AMD released their quad core Phenom X4 range at the same time and Intel did have some quad core CPUs in early 2007.
Is Crysis just badly optimized?
Rather than being well or badly optimized, Crysis just scales very well at low settings but badly at high settings.

Why is Crysis so difficult to run on PC?
Even after all these years, Crysis can still punish high-end PC hardware. What made the game so difficult to run? It was a confluence of many factors, combined with a desire by developer Crytek to push the limits of software and hardware.
